![](https://images.gutefrage.net/media/default/user/9_nmmslarge.png?v=1551279448000)
![](https://images.gutefrage.net/media/user/MartaDerMacher/1678343644339_nmmslarge__198_0_852_852_772513df417b3de0d55c895d8f27aa23.jpg?v=1678343644000)
Der 80386-Prozessor ist ein 32-Bit-Prozessor und kann daher nicht direkt mit dem 8.8-Format arbeiten. Um eine Multiplikation von AX mit π im 8.8-Format auf einem 80386-Prozessor durchzuführen, müssen die Daten zunächst in das entsprechende Format umgewandelt werden.
Das 8.8-Format bedeutet, dass die Zahl in zwei Teile aufgeteilt wird: die oberen 8 Bits repräsentieren den ganzzahligen Anteil und die unteren 8 Bits repräsentieren den Nachkommanteil. Um π im 8.8-Format darzustellen, müssten Sie es zuerst in dieses Format umwandeln.
π hat eine unendliche Anzahl von Nachkommastellen, so dass es nicht möglich ist, es vollständig im 8.8-Format darzustellen. Sie könnten jedoch eine Näherung von π im 8.8-Format verwenden.
Eine mögliche Näherung von π im 8.8-Format ist 3.14 (00000011.00101110). Um AX mit 3.14 im 8.8-Format zu multiplizieren, müssten Sie zunächst AX in das 8.8-Format umwandeln. Angenommen, AX hat den Wert 1234 (hexadezimal 0x04D2). Dann würde die Umwandlung von AX in das 8.8-Format wie folgt aussehen:
1234 (dezimal)
= 0x04D2 (hexadezimal)
= 00000100.11010010 (binär, mit führenden Nullen aufgefüllt)